10m for a downpipe? WTF? That REALLY is overdoing it M8, I've wrapped about 9 downpipe now and have only ever used 7m at the most. Stainless Steel Tiewraps are perfect for securing the wrap. I have 2 cars, right now, that have their wrap fitted like this, secured this way, been on the cars for 21/23 months and not a single issue with the CoolTek wrap. Just because it is a bit thicker doesn't mean its better! Will it protect to the same temps? Russell (open to a debate on this as I will be happy to change to an exhaust wrap that someone CAN PROVE IS BETTER!)
